Output 39075c301905302b7c592e8dff0df1daab1919e7a95db8b6180517563970934c:0

value
15584817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c94a6e7469a0a51daa1d186e722b4abeea87ef OP_EQUAL
address
MV828ruL2xzMeT6sunr5LiL8fzSzLeVGJT
transaction
39075c301905302b7c592e8dff0df1daab1919e7a95db8b6180517563970934c
spent
true